Output 56692f15031f725c885bbed5935c7e1d2fe42a39f2a49c8ab5c3797f91e5ed0a:2

value
37415408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89516b0c7e32f35160733209cdea21b1109e383a OP_EQUAL
address
MLRELk6YT6p8ig7agLh9b3KbHAV7AqNzFZ
transaction
56692f15031f725c885bbed5935c7e1d2fe42a39f2a49c8ab5c3797f91e5ed0a
spent
true